Transaction efc81e76800d155f3b7a8869ddf56393b0f0ea12117de28134a7804ba47fdc07
1 Input
1 Output
-
efc81e76800d155f3b7a8869ddf56393b0f0ea12117de28134a7804ba47fdc07:0
- value
- 442998
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ebe7780122a6b18801194b9c087da016e68a8399 OP_EQUAL
- address
- 3PCN1MbBYktYKKNR2bJEDiNoxGLzZUniaT